Everyone’s relationship with substances is different. Some people might use them to relax, to fit in, or to cope when things feel difficult. It’s a part of life for many — but sometimes, substance use can start to affect your wellbeing, your choices, or your relationships.
In LifeSkills: Substance Misuse, you’ll explore what substance misuse means, why it can happen, and how to recognise when things might be getting too much. You’ll also learn practical ways to make changes, seek support, and build healthier habits.
